JOHN'S EPISCOPAL CHURCH FISHERS ISLAND The undersigned Rector and qualified voters of St. John's Episcopal Church Fishers Island(formerly named St.John's Protestant Episcopal Church of Fishers Island,New York and hereinafter called the"Church")hereby certify that: I. At a meeting of the Vestry of the Church on April 7, 2009,the following resolutions were duly adopted by unanimous vote of the members of the Vestry present: RESOLVED,that the Vestry of St. John's Episcopal Church Fishers Island(the "Church")hereby recommends that Paragraphs 3 and 4 of the first resolution set forth in the Certificate of Amendment of the Certificate of Incorporation of the Church ratified at a special meeting of qualified voters of the Church on July 29, 1984 be amended in their entirety to read as follows: "3. At such next annual election one of the two church wardens shall be elected to hold office for one year and the other to hold office for two years, and thereafter there shall be elected at each annual election one church warden to hold office for two years; and each church warden who has been elected for three consecutive full terms of office shall be ineligible for reelection as a church warden until the annual election following that at which his third consecutive full term of office expired;and further "4. The number of vestrymen shall be increased from eight to nine;there shall be elected at such next annual election one-third of such number of vestrymen to hold office for three years, one-third to hold office for two years and one-third to hold office for one year,and thereafter there shall be elected at each annual election to hold office for three years one-third of such number of vestrymen; and each vestryman who has been elected for two full terms of office shall be ineligible for reelection as a vestryman until the annual election following that at which his second full tern of office expired; and farther". RESOLVED,that notice of the foregoing recommendation shall be included in the notice of a special meeting of qualified voters of the Church,which shall be held in the Church on Sunday July 26,2009 following the 10:00 A.M. service; at such meeting such recommendation shall be submitted for ratification,and if such recommendation be ratified by such meeting,the presiding officer and at least two qualified voters present at such meeting shall execute,acknowledge and cause to be filed in the office of the County Clerk, State of New York,County of Suffolk,the certificate as to such ratification required by law. II. Notice of the recommendation of the Vestry set forth in the above resolutions was given with the notice of a special meeting of qualified voters of the Church duly called by the Vestry and held on July 26, 2009. The Rector was the presiding officer of such meeting, and such resolutions and the recommendation of the Vestry set forth therein were ratified and approved by vote of the qualified voters present at the meeting, so that Paragraphs 3 and 4 of the first resolution set forth in the Certificate of Amendment of the Certificate of Incorporation of the Church ratified at a special meeting of qualified voters of the Church on July 29, 1984 are amended to read in their entirety as set forth above.
